Sablon introduced a range of 1/43 scale vehicles in 1968, followed by Mercedes trucks. Sablon produced vehicles for Jacques Super Chocolat as part of a chocolate promotion, such models marked Jaques rather than Sablon. Models were also provided by Sablon for Japanese manufacturer Yonezawa and Spanish maker Nacoral. Sablon at one time sold smaller models by Efsi of Holland. These were approximately Matchbox sized models, in blister packs.
Sablon are remembered for the wheels and tyres of their models. Due to a chemical reaction between the materials used for wheels and tyres, most, if not all, of those seen today are deformed, as illustrated by the images below.
